Securing sensitive data while improving user experiences has become an absolute priority. Organizations face challenges that require balancing robust security measures without hindering accessibility or operational efficiency. In this post, we’ll explore how combining passwordless authentication with dynamic data masking (DDM) creates a practical, scalable, and secure approach to safeguarding sensitive data.
Key Problems Passwordless Authentication and DDM Solve
Password fatigue, phishing, and credential theft weigh heavily on both developers and end-users. Adding to this, protecting sensitive data—such as personal identifiable information (PII) or financial records—requires layers of protection to avoid leaks, breaches, or regulatory penalties.
Passwordless authentication eliminates the reliance on traditional credentials. Simultaneously, dynamic data masking restricts sensitive information exposure while still allowing authorized users access to masked data that respects their roles or access privileges. Together, they provide a superior solution for minimizing risk.
The Synergy Between Passwordless Authentication and Dynamic Data Masking
When properly integrated, these two technologies reinforce one another:
1. Reduced Risk of Credential Theft
Passwordless systems commonly use biometrics, hardware tokens, or magic links—eliminating passwords from workflows. Users interact with streamlined, secure authentication methods that reduce entry points for bad actors.
Paired with dynamic data masking, even compromised access routes won’t expose critical data fields under typical attack vectors. For example, instead of viewing raw credit card information or social security numbers, an attacker only sees masked content like “XXXX-XXXX-1234.”
2. Simplified Compliance for Sensitive Data
For compliance frameworks like GDPR and HIPAA, controlling data exposure across user roles or geographies is vital. Dynamic data masking ensures minimal visibility for lower-privileged team members, partners, or external auditors.
By adding passwordless access to this equation, even admin-level access is gated with advanced authentication layers. This dual approach meets compliance demands while making unauthorized access harder than ever.
3. Seamless User Experience with Layered Security
Developers often struggle to maintain usability when baking complex security protocols into workflows. Passwordless authentication removes friction in logins, replacing old protocols with one-tap verification or push notifications.
Meanwhile, dynamic data masking guarantees secure access to sensitive information without interrupting standard tasks for users needing limited visibility. For example, developers reviewing logs might see sanitized error outputs, while authorized managers get full details unlocked only after identity confirmation.
Implementing Passwordless Authentication and DDM
Achieving this level of security doesn’t require you to start from scratch. Many modern platforms and APIs enable interoperability between identity providers, passwordless frameworks, and masking policies. Here’s what implementation typically involves:
- Step 1: Choose Your Authentication Flow
Select methods suitable to your environment: biometric logins, emailed magic links, or push notifications. - Step 2: Define Masking Rules for Sensitive Data
Decide which data fields need masking and under what conditions (e.g., anonymizing PII for external contractors). - Step 3: Integrate Data Exposure Logic
Implement dynamic masking at the middleware or database level. Use role-driven access controls to unmask fields based on tokenized credentials.
See Passwordless Authentication in Action with Hoop.dev
Testing secure, scalable solutions shouldn’t take weeks or months to prototype. With hoop.dev, you can integrate passwordless authentication workflows and data-masking APIs within minutes, not hours.
Ready to elevate your data protection strategy without compromising usability? Explore hoop.dev and deploy a live, passwordless + DDM setup today.